#             3-Day Forecast
#
A. NOAA Geomagnetic Activity Observation and Forecast

The greatest observed 3 hr Kp over the past 24 hours was 4 (below NOAA
Scale levels).
The greatest expected 3 hr Kp for May 02-May 04 2026 is 4.00 (below NOAA
Scale levels).

NOAA Kp index breakdown May 02-May 04 2026

             May 02       May 03       May 04
00-03UT       2.33         2.67         2.67
03-06UT       2.33         3.00         3.00
06-09UT       3.00         4.00         2.67
09-12UT       2.67         2.67         2.67
12-15UT       2.00         2.33         1.67
15-18UT       2.00         1.67         1.67
18-21UT       1.67         1.67         0.67
21-00UT       2.67         2.67         2.67

Rationale: No G1 (Minor) or greater geomagnetic storms are expected.  No
significant transient or recurrent solar wind features are forecast.

B. NOAA Solar Radiation Activity Observation and Forecast

Solar radiation, as observed by NOAA GOES-18 over the past 24 hours, was
below S-scale storm level thresholds.

Solar Radiation Storm Forecast for May 02-May 04 2026

              May 02  May 03  May 04
S1 or greater    1%      1%      1%

Rationale: No S1 (Minor) or greater solar radiation storms are expected.
No significant active region activity favorable for radiation storm
production is forecast.

C. NOAA Radio Blackout Activity and Forecast

No radio blackouts were observed over the past 24 hours.

Radio Blackout Forecast for May 02-May 04 2026

              May 02        May 03        May 04
R1-R2           40%           40%           40%
R3 or greater    5%            5%            5%

Rationale: There exists a chance for R1-R2 (Minor-Moderate) radio
blackouts over 02-04 May due to the potential from multiple complex
regions on the Suns visible disk.
